About this item

  • Immediate High Shear Strength and Handling – Resists High-Range Temperature Cycling – Creates Permanent Seal
  • This 3M heavy-duty pressure-sensitive adhesive with an acrylic foam core distributes stress over the entire surface for a good balance of strength and conformability
  • The virtually invisible fastening keeps surfaces smooth and can replace rivets, screws, spot welds, and messy liquid adhesives in appropriate applications
  • Application: powder coat, liquid paint processes, high operating temperature applications, panel to frame, decorative material, trim, internal components, small appliances, skyscrapers, architectural windows, cell phones, retail signs, trucking
  • TapeCase has been an authorized 3M Preferred Converter for over 20 years; We convert authentic 3M solutions into precise width, shape, and length needed to facilitate your bonding application, including complex parts or parts with narrow bonding surfaces


3M VHB Heavy Duty Mounting Tape 5952 is a Red, 0.045 inch (1.1 millimeter) modified acrylic adhesive with a very conformable, foam core. This tape has been converted from 3M VHB Tape 5952.

If you need a good double-sided tape that's removable, DON'T BUY this! If, on the other hand, you need double-sided tape to stick two things together for good, this is the stuff you need.OK, I suppose you could pry this apart if you really needed to, but you are going to have your work cut out for you. This is seriously sticky double-sided tape meant for industrial applications. I've used it to stick plastic to aluminum, rubber to steel plate, fiberglass to metal, etc. One repair was for a tractor fiberglass panel, one for an outside sign and one for a metal plate I use as a portable anvil that needs a rubber backing to absorb hammer blows. In all cases, this stuff has lasted years with no separation, no slippage, no nothing other than doing the job it was intended to do.My only negative is that once the exposed side is stuck, it's tricky to peel off the protective red separation layer from the other side. But that's a one-time challenge for a lifetime of intended use.

I recently moved to Colorado, a state that requires front license plates on motor vehicles. My Sprinter van has a license-plate-sized flat area on the front bumper but no pre-drilled holes. In my previous home in New Mexico this wasn't an issue, front license plates were not required. I wasn't thrilled about drilling holes and hoping for the best in what amounts to a plastic bumper, so I looked into alternatives. I saw this product discussed and recommended repeatedly on 'van life' videos, frequently for attaching flexible solar panels directly to the roof of the vehicle. Several were multi-year tests without any problems, no solar panels flying off the roofs, etc.I decided to give this a shot. The roll of tape arrived with zero instructions. None. It was early December in CO and I wasn't sure about minimum temperature requirements, so I went to the product page on the 3M website. Room temperatures recommended (uh oh!) but application seemed OK down to around temps in the 50s F. I waited for a warm-ish day. We had a clear sunny day with a high projected in the mid to upper 50s - it's only going to get colder in the next couple months so it was now or Spring.FYI the day before I worked indoors, cut three strips of tape and applied to the license plate, leaving the backing on, and clamped it overnight.I parked the van with the front bumper pointed south. Washed the area with very warm soapy water, rinsed with very warm water. let it dry and then sprayed and then wiped alcohol on the area (I know, 'belt and suspenders' approach). Peeled off the backing and applied the plate to the bumper, pressed as hard as I could and for as long as these old, arthritic hands could muster, probably was only a couple minutes though it felt like forever. So far all is well. The license plate is still attached, have been on very rough roads, highway at 60+ mph, all good. Time will tell.
